Noun [Albanian]

Forms: sumbulla [plural]
Etymology: From Proto-Albanian *tˢumba, from Proto-Indo-European *ḱumbʰ- (compare English hump, Latin incumbere (“to lie down”), Ancient Greek κύμβη (kúmbē, “bowl; boat”)).
